Cryptocurrency and the Democratization of Sports Betting
Cryptocurrencies, by their very nature, promote borderless transactions and minimal intermediaries, aligning perfectly with the global, inclusive ethos of modern sports betting. Leading platforms now integrate digital assets as the primary means of transaction, enabling faster, more secure deposits and withdrawals.
Industry insights highlight a growing trend—an increase in crypto-based wagering, with data indicating a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of over 20% in this segment since 2020 (Source: Crypto Gambling Report 2023). This shift underscores a demand for more transparent and fair betting mechanisms, where blockchain’s immutable ledger plays a crucial role.
